What they do

A Meteorologist studies the weather and other aspects of the atmosphere and atmospheric science. Analyses weather and climate data, reports current weather conditions and develops weather forecasts.

About Gray Media:

Today, we are a growing multimedia company head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ia. We are the nation's largest owner of top-rated local television stations and digital assets serving 117 full-power television markets that collectively reach approximately 37% of US television households. The portfolio includes 80 markets with the top-rated television station and 100 markets with the first- and/or second-highest-rated television station in average all-day ratings across 116 such markets measured by Nielsen in 2025. We also own the largest Telemundo Affiliate group with 46 markets and Gray Digital Media, a full-service digital agency offering national and local clients digital marketing strategies with the most advanced digital products and services. Our additional media properties include video production companies Raycom Sports, Tupelo Media Group, and PowerNation Studios, and studio production facilities Assembly Atlanta and Third Rail Studios.

Job Summary/Description:

KXII 12, the weather leader in the Texoma region, is looking to add a weekend meteorologist to the market's most experienced First Alert weather team. The right candidate will have a combination of broadcast, digital, and technological expertise to tell weather stories on a variety of platforms. This meteorologist will anchor our weekend evening newscasts, as well as serve as the primary fill-in both AM & PM weekdays. This is a full-time position based out of our studios in Sherman, Texas, located between Dallas and Oklahoma City in the heart of Tornado Alley. Duties/Responsibilities will include (but not be limited to) the following: ˑ Serve as primary weather anchor for the station's weekend newscasts ˑ Fill in on the air in weekday AM & PM newscasts as needed (including holidays) ˑ Serve as CTV anchor/producer for 30-minute First Alert Weather Extra show three nights/week ˑ Serve as primary talent for digital & social video forecasts and live broadcasts ˑ Design weather graphics for the department with an emphasis on "lifestyle forecasting" ˑ Produce weather graphics and information to regularly update our website, apps, and social media platforms ˑ Occasionally report live on weather conditions ˑ Occasionally report on weather-related events and topics
